Route analysis

The route from Chicago to Washington spans 1,121 kilometers with an estimated drive time of 790 minutes. Drivers will find 553 charging stations along the way, offering frequent opportunities for stops, though the distance suggests at least one or two charging sessions will be necessary for most EVs. Both cities experience a normal climate, so no significant cold-weather range reduction is expected. Washington has 287 charging stations compared to Chicago's 156, indicating better infrastructure at the destination for final charging or overnight top-ups. The route is not cross-border, eliminating customs or charging standard concerns. The terrain between these cities is largely flat to gently rolling, which supports consistent energy consumption. For EV drivers, planning a mid-route charging stop around the 550-kilometer mark, likely in a city like Columbus or Pittsburgh, would be practical to avoid range anxiety, with ample station density ensuring backup options.
